#### Build in a Docker container
Build script: [build-img-docker.sh](scripts/build-img-docker.sh), which can be set 0/6/8 parameters. The script will automatically download a Docker image of openEuler and import it into the local system. The Docker image version is determined by the script's parameter: DOCKER_FILE.
Caution, before running the script, you need to install Docker.
1. Build with default parameters
`sudo bash build-img-docker.sh`
2. Build with custom parameters
`sudo bash build-img-docker.sh DOCKER_FILE KERNEL_URL KERNEL_BRANCH KERNEL_DEFCONFIG DEFAULT_DEFCONFIG REPO_FILE --cores MAKE_CORES`
or
`sudo bash build-img-docker.sh DOCKER_FILE KERNEL_URL KERNEL_BRANCH KERNEL_DEFCONFIG DEFAULT_DEFCONFIG REPO_FILE`
In addition to the first parameter DOCKER_FILE, the other parameters are the same as the corresponding parameters in "Build on host":
- DOCKER_FILE: The URL or name of the Docker image, which defaults to `https://repo.openeuler.org/openEuler-20.03-LTS/docker_img/aarch64/openEuler-docker.aarch64.tar.xz`. With the default parameter, the script will automatically download the Docker image of openEuler 20.03 LTS and import it into the local system. Caution, if DOCKER_FILE is a file name, please make sure this file in the config directory. Otherwise, if DOCKER_FILE is a URL, please make sure you can get a correct Docker image from this URL.

#### Docker 容器内构建
构建脚本 [build-img-docker.sh](scripts/build-img-docker.sh),其后可设置 0/6/8 个参数。该脚本会自动下载 openEuler 的 Docker 镜像,并导入本机系统中,下载并导入的 Docker 镜像版本由该脚本参数 DOCKER_FILE 决定。
注意!!!运行该脚本前,需安装 Docker 运行环境。
1. 使用脚本默认参数构建
`sudo bash build-img-docker.sh`
2. 自行设置参数构建
`sudo bash build-img-docker.sh DOCKER_FILE KERNEL_URL KERNEL_BRANCH KERNEL_DEFCONFIG DEFAULT_DEFCONFIG REPO_FILE --cores MAKE_CORES`
`sudo bash build-img-docker.sh DOCKER_FILE KERNEL_URL KERNEL_BRANCH KERNEL_DEFCONFIG DEFAULT_DEFCONFIG REPO_FILE`
其中,除第一个参数 DOCKER_FILE 外,剩余参数与`主机上构建`中对应参数一致:
- DOCKER_FILE:Docker 镜像的 URL 或者文件名称, 默认为 `https://repo.openeuler.org/openEuler-20.03-LTS/docker_img/aarch64/openEuler-docker.aarch64.tar.xz`。使用该默认参数时,脚本会自动下载 openEuler 20.03 LTS 的 Docker 镜像,并导入本机系统中。注意,如果 DOCKER_FILE 为文件名称,需要保证该文件在本目录的 config 文件夹下。否则,如果 DOCKER_FILE 为 URL,请保证可以通过该链接获取到该 Docker 镜像。
